The SSM3J134TU is a P-channel MOSFET from Toshiba Semiconductor and Storage, designed primarily for load switching and power management in portable devices. It offers a combination of low on-resistance, fast switching speed, and compact packaging, making it suitable for applications where board space is limited and high efficiency is required.
Applications:
- Load Switching: Used to control power to various circuits in portable devices, such as smartphones, tablets, and wearables.
- DC-DC Conversion: Employed in step-up and step-down converters to regulate voltage levels in power supplies.
- Power Management Circuits: Incorporated into battery management systems (BMS) for efficient power distribution.
- Portable Electronics: Suitable for use in a wide range of battery-powered consumer electronics devices.
- Solid State Relays: Can function as a switch element in solid-state relay applications.
Features:
- Low On-Resistance (RDS(on)): Minimizes power loss, increasing overall efficiency.
- Fast Switching Speed: Allows for efficient operation in high-frequency applications.
- Low Gate Charge (Qg): Reduces the amount of power required to drive the MOSFET.
- Small Surface Mount Package: Allows for a compact design and efficient use of board space.
- RoHS Compliant: Meets environmental standards for lead-free manufacturing.
